Techblog
Nathan's thoughts on technology, programming, and everything else. Delivered with straight-faced sarcasm.
The Right Number of Comments in Code
Good comments explain intent, but figuring out when they're useless is an entirely different kind of war.
Continuing the blog upkeep
I figured out how to rewrite URLs and run markdown, only to discover the universal agony of web plumbing.
How Much Documentation is Enough?
Rethink your guidelines.
Finally updating my blog tools
I rebuilt my blogging platform from scratch using Vue.js and modern SPA techniques.
Dopefly update
Just random housekeeping thoughts
Nobody's doing UWP
Nobody's doing UWP, but the tools are actively fighting you.
What it's like switching from ColdFusion to C#
Is a "Helper" an object? A taxonomy headache. Diving into the architectural chaos of C#.
How I switched to C# in just 15 years
ColdFusion paid the bills, but C# wrote the future. A career retrospective.
From Miami to Nassau
The eternal language war: which boat actually makes it from Miami to Nassau?
Why we're moving away from ColdFusion
Why sacrifice proven tech for a market trend? The answer is definitely not about the code.